Monroe driver arrested for 50th time
This article originally published Friday, January 26, 2007 by Peyton Whitely - Seattle Times Eastside bureau at The Seattle Times .

A driver who had been arrested 49 times, including eight convictions for driving with a suspended license, made it an even 50 when she was stopped on Interstate 405 near Highway 520 on Wednesday night by the State Patrol....
